Guruji Brings City Specific Search Service For Pune

Guruji.com, India's first search engine has launched city specific search for Pune. With this new service, Guruji wants to ensure Puneites quick and accurate local search results. For instance, a user enters a keyword, say "restaurants in pune", he would get local business listings, articles, reviews, blogs or any other web references of the searched item from Guruji.com pages.

Upbeat Anurag Dod, CEO and Co-founder of Guruji.com explains, "What sets us apart is our focus on the Indian market and the Indian consumer. When an Indian consumer types in a search keyword like 'newspaper' the results should show him websites of the top Indian newspapers rather than other news sites which are not relevant to him."
